Established in 2012 by Jason Shaw, Blue Paw Energy Services is led by a Texas licensed master electrician and the nation’s first deaf certified solar installer. We are honored to have won two Entrepreneur of the Year awards. Mr. Shaw is a deaf master electrician with over 20 years of experience in the electrical field, specializing in both residential and commercial projects, including energy management. He is also the first deaf individual in the nation to achieve certification as a solar installer. In 2012, Mr. Shaw established Blue Paw Energy Service to provide energy efficiency solutions, initially targeting the deaf community for easier communication, yet he is open to working with any homeowners, commercial property owners, or clients to find ways to lower energy usage. Hired blue paw for a variety of electrical work on our main panel, namely: Installing an energy meter, installing a whole house surge protector and replacing some breakers with a lower-amperage ones. Jason showed up on time, did an excellent work and finished all work in about 1.5 hours. Although I said I had all the necessary parts, he saw that some more parts were needed and he went and bought the parts before starting.
I was actually surprised that he did not count the time he went to get the parts in his bill (because it was really my fault that the parts were missing). His bill was very reasonable (actually much cheaper than I expected).
One other thing I was surprised was that he never turn off the power at the panel while working. So we never lost power during his work.
